Copyediting
Improvements for accuracy, nuance, concision, and natural expression.
Sentence-level rewrites to improve clarity, reduce ambiguity, and remove unnecessary repetition.
Checks of key details such as names, dates, titles, authors, and cited works.
Light edits to improve transitions and connections, so the writing reads smoothly from one idea to the next.
Tone refinements to suit your context, whether academic, business, creative, or another style altogether.
Consistent spelling, punctuation, capitalisation, formatting, and style choices.
All edits visible in red so you can review every change, from small corrections to sentence-level refinements.
I leave clear comments in the document when your input may be helpful, giving you the chance to clarify meaning, confirm details, or choose between possible phrasings.
Revised PDF plus a Word/Pages document with tracked changes and comments.
Copyediting is ideal when your text has a solid argument or structure in place, but needs closer attention to clarity, tone, flow, expression, and consistency.


Understanding the boundaries of copyediting.
Copyediting does not include substantial reordering, rewriting, or reshaping of sections.
I do not add new content or carry out extensive research beyond pinpoint fact-checking.
Layout design, typesetting, and complex document formatting are not included unless agreed separately.
